IPL 2024: Anil Kumble has given a big statement regarding Mahendra Singh Dhoni playing in IPL 2024. Kumble has said that it is not easy to make any guess about what Dhoni does.

IPL 2024: Former Indian team coach Anil Kumble has said that it will not be easy for Mahendra Singh Dhoni (MS Dhoni) to play in this season of the Indian Premier League (IPL 2024). Kumble believes that due to knee injury and lack of match practice, it may be difficult for Dhoni in the new season. Dhoni has been retained by Chennai Super Kings. Along with this, the team released 8 players before the mini-auction of IPL 2024. 26th November was the deadline for the retention of players.

Under the captaincy of Dhoni, Chennai Super Kings has won the IPL title five times. Chennai defeated Gujarat Titans in the final in 2023. Despite a knee injury, Dhoni played all 16 matches. He had scored only 104 runs but his strike rate was more than 180.

After the 2023 IPL, Dhoni left an emotional message for the fans. He said he had thanked the fans for their support and love. He had said, ‘It would have been very easy for me to say thank you and retire. But with the kind of love I have received from the fans of Chennai Super Kings, So I want to give them a gift by playing one more season.

Dhoni underwent knee surgery after the IPL season. This surgery took place at Kokila Dhirubhai Ambani Hospital in Mumbai.

Kumble said in a conversation with Geo Cinema, ‘I think last year was a good example. We all know that he was not 100 percent fit. But even after this, he played important roles both behind and in front of the stumps. You had time but you have not played any cricket. This is not going to be easy. He has undergone knee surgery. He will have to work very hard.

But he is such a player who does not give any idea of what he is going to do. We have seen how he said goodbye to international cricket. I am sure that the fans and players would like him to play the entire season. I have full confidence that if he prepared and kept himself ready for the season. So he will play the whole season.

CSK IPL 2024 retention

Players released: Ben Stokes, Dwayne Pretorius, Bhagat Verma, Subhranshu Senapathy, Ambati Rayudu (retired), Akash Singh, Kyle Jamieson, and Sisanda Magala.

The players retained are: Ruturaj Gaikwad, Devon Conway, Moeen Ali, Shivam Dubey, Ravindra Jadeja, MS Dhoni (captain & wk), Ajinkya Rahane, Deepak Chahar, Mahesh Theekshana, Mukesh Chaudhary, Mitchell Santner, Rajvardhan Hungergekar, Simarjeet Singh, Mathisha Pathirana, Tushar Deshpande, Prashant Solanki, Sheikh Rasheed, Nishant Sindhu, Ajay Mandal.
